    Abstract: A digital television (DTV) signal for use in a DTV receiver includes an extended text table (ETT) which includes a header and a message body. The header includes a table identification extension field which serves to establish uniqueness of the ETT, and the message includes an extended text message (ETM). If the ETT is an event ETT, the table ID extension field includes an event identification which specifies an identification number of an event associated with the ETT. On the other hand, if the ETT is a channel ETT, the table identification extension field includes a source identification which specifies a programming source of a virtual channel associated with the ETT. A section-filtering unit included in the DTV receiver is able to use table identification extension fields of a plurality of ETTs for section-filtering a pertinent event or channel ETT from the ETTs.

    Abstract: An analog television signal data delivery system provides a television program, called a data show, that is transmitted across standard television broadcast methods to data needy client systems, such as settop boxes, at certain times of the day. When the data show is recorded and specially demodulated it provides the client system with raw digital data to perform required or enhanced functions. Binary digital data is modulated into each frame of the data show. Each of the 480 scan lines in a frame have data modulated into it. Each scan line in the frame contains two bytes which yields 28800 bytes/sec. This high transfer rate results in an efficient data transfer method that is cost effective and easily broadcast. Another preferred embodiment of the invention designates some regions of the active video picture to contain visible images and other regions of the active picture to contain data. The non-data portions can be placed anywhere on the viewable frame.
